Hello Noel, 2011/12/17 Noel Grandin <noelgran...@gmail.com>: > Hi > > Yeah, that is what I tried the first time. > But it turns out to be incredibly hard to keep the lifecycle of the > ScBaseCell objects and the lifecycle of the ScPostIt objects tied > together, because ScBaseCell and it's child classes get allocated and > deallocated in lots of different places, not just in ScTable. >
Can you give me a caode pointer where we create a cell with a note that is not created in our call chain ScDocument->ScTable->ScColumn? Your current solution has some nasty problems. We would save all notes from all documents (including undo and copy documents) in one big container. If I'm not totally misguided there should be no big problem to move the container to ScTable. That might result in slow lookup for complex documents. My idea how it should work: (all methods in ScTable) - DeleteCol, DeleteRow, DeleteArea need to check for an ScPostIt that needs to be deleted - CopyToClip copies the whole container to the table in the copy document - the undo methods do the same There might be some hiddent raps here but I think we can work them out.
